here is the bike suspension set up for gsxr600 k4, it is available in Performance Bike magazine in last month issue:

 

STANDARD

Rear shock

preload: 7mm showing above top ring

rebound: 1.5 turns out fromfull in

compression: 1.5 turns out from full in

 

Forks

preload: 4 lines showing

rebound: 1.5 turns out from full in

compression: 1.5 turns out from full in

 

TRACK

Rear shock

preload: 7mm showing above top ring

rebound: 1.25 turns out from full in

compression: 1 turn out from full in

 

Forks

preload: 4 lines showing

rebound: 0.5 turn out from full in

compression: 0.5 turn out from full in

 

Tyre pressure

front: 31psi

rear: 30psi

 

 

 

 

Please take note! the above information stated is only a general reference, believe and apply at the rider's own risk and discretion. Accidents occured are not the responsible of the author.
